Transaction ecdcb325a3aab987054d12ec3e0211f9e974d48af7805d7aa8ad3ea3672490c0
1 Input
1 Output
-
ecdcb325a3aab987054d12ec3e0211f9e974d48af7805d7aa8ad3ea3672490c0:0
- value
- 51677
- script pubkey
- OP_0 OP_PUSHBYTES_20 d40c5044e605bfe0261e64ed8d5000bece76259c
- address
- bc1q6sx9q38xqkl7qfs7vnkc65qqhm88vfvu96k00g